For only the 11th time ever the March Madness championship game will be contested by a pair of No.1 seeds: the Houston Cougars and Florida Gators. Houston, beaten finalists in '83 and '84, have never lifted the title before, whereas Florida have won the tournament twice, when they became the first team to go back-to-back in '06 and '07.

For an NCAA Tournament that has already made history for its astonishing dearth of Cinderella stories, it's somewhat ironic that the No.1-seeded finalists had to pull off a pair of upsets in order to reach the championship game.

No.3 Houston took down No.2 Duke, bringing the curtain abruptly down on projected No.1 NBA Draft pick Cooper Flagg's college career in the process, while No.4 Florida got the better of overall No.1 seed Auburn and college basketball's other superstar, Johni Broome.

In both instances, the Cougars and Gators looked dead and buried moments before the buzzer. Grit and mental fortitude have been the running themes of both programs' March Madness runs, but who will be the last team standing?

How many teams are in March Madness each year?

Of the 351 fully-fledged Division I basketball programs, only 64 make it to the Big Dance.

60 teams — the 32 postseason championship winners and the 28 highest-rated teams according to the selection committee — qualify for the First Round.

The remaining four spots are contested by eight further teams, by way of the sudden-death First Four mini tournament.

What are our March Madness 2025 predictions?

March Madness has a frustrating habit — or wonderful knack — of defying expectations. Only once in the 85-year history of the tournament have all four No.1 seeds made it to the Final Four. That happened in 2008.

Yet the No.1 seeds are statistically the likeliest teams to lift the championship title. 25 No.1 seeds have gone on to win March Madness, compared to just five No.2 seeds, four No.3 seeds, and two No.4 seeds.

So rather than trying to will a Cinderella team into existence, you're best off going with one of the four favorites.

UConn are the back-to-back reigning champions, having become only the eighth program to ever retained the title. The previous team to do so was Florida in 2007.

What’s the biggest ever March Madness Cinderella story?

As the lowest-seeded program to win the NCAA tournament, the Villanova Wildcats class of 1985 remains the biggest ever March Madness Cinderella team. They went all the way, while ranked as No.8 seeds.

Only two other No.8 seeds, the Butler Bulldogs class of 2011 and the North Carolina Tar Heels class of 2022, have made it to the championship game.

However, a special mention goes out to the No.11-seeded Loyola Marymount Lions class of 1990. As No.11 seeds, they became the first WCC team to reach the Elite Eight in 33 years, after their 23-year-old star Hank Gathers suffered a heart attack on court during their conference semi-final and died.
